  • Publication number: 20140040161
    Abstract: A method and system for a business to manage negative feedback reviews submitted on a public review webpage by a customer. The method includes registering with a review management service, assigning a unique identifier and a profile page to the business, encouraging a customer to submit a review of the business using the unique identifier, and providing, to the business, information from the review management service which enables the business to counter or manage negative reviews. Thereby, a business can be notified when a negative feedback review is submitted by a customer prior to the negative feedback review being submitted to a public review webpage. The method also includes enabling businesses to receive notification of feedback for individual employees to take appropriate corrective action. Further, the business can provide customers with rewards as an incentive or encouragement to complete reviews with the goal of obtaining positive reviews from satisfied customers.

  • Patent number: 8637063
    Abstract: The invention provides methods of making hydrolyzed cross-linked pol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) hydrogels by polymerizing vinyl acetate (VAc) monomers to polyvinyl acetate (PVAc) polymer network by chemical-crosslinking and hydrolysis. The invention also provides methods for including pendant chains in the hydrogel during the polymerization process. Materials produced and use of the cross-linked hydrolyzed PVA hydrogels also are disclosed herein.
